[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of gas water heaters, in particular to a burner, a burner device and a gas water heater. BACKGROUND
[0002] A gas water heater is a gas appliance that uses gas as fuel to heat water. The gas water heater mainly includes a burner, a heat exchanger, a gas supply device and a water supply device. On the one hand, the gas supply device is used to supply air and gas to the burner, and when the air and gas are mixed and ignited in the burner, the heat exchanger can be heated. On the other hand, the water supply device is used to supply cold water into the heat exchanger, and the heated water in the heat exchanger can be supplied to the water system to meet the user's demand.
[0003] The burner in the related art includes a burner shell and a fire grate. A premixing cavity is arranged in the burner shell, and the fire grate is installed on the top of the burner shell. When the burner works, the variable frequency fan is used to inject the gas and air according to the pre-calculated air-gas ratio to ensure that the air and gas are fully mixed in the premixing cavity, and finally the mixed gas is discharged through the fire grate and ignited and burned. The load adjustment of the burner is mainly based on the change of the rotating speed of the variable frequency fan to control the supply amount of the mixed gas.
[0004] However, such a structure has an inherent bottleneck: when the load of the burner is adjusted to be low, the air flow speed will be reduced to below the flame propagation speed, at which time the fire grate is prone to backfire, which seriously restricts the stable working range of the burner. This technical bottleneck directly leads to the difficulty of further reducing the minimum heat load of the gas water heater, limits the adjustment range of the water temperature, and is difficult to meet the user's demand for wider temperature range and more precise water temperature control.

[0065] In the related art, when the load of the combustor 202 is reduced, the gas flow rate will be reduced to below the flame propagation speed. At this time, backfire is prone to occur at the fire grate 4, which seriously restricts the stable working range of the combustor 202 and directly leads to the difficulty of further reducing the minimum heat load of the gas water heater, limiting the water temperature adjustment range and being difficult to meet the user's use demand for wider temperature range and more precise water temperature control.
[0066] Based on the above problems, the combustor 202 provided by the present application can avoid backfire under low load of the combustor 202 by optimizing the flow path of the premixing flow channel 10 inside the combustor 202 and the structure of the fire grate 4, which is conducive to widening the water temperature adjustment range and meeting the user's use demand for wider temperature range and more precise water temperature control.
[0067] Continue asFigures 3 to 4 As shown, the fire row 4 comprises a fire row body 41 and a first fire outlet structure 42, a plurality of first fire outlet structures 42 arranged in a first direction form a first fire outlet structure group, and a plurality of first fire outlet structure groups are arranged in a second direction; wherein the fire row body 41 is provided with a protrusion 421, the protrusion 421 is provided with a first fire outlet hole 422 communicating with the premix flow channel 10, the diameter of the first fire outlet hole 422 is smaller than the quenching diameter of the gas, and the protrusion 421 and the first fire outlet hole 422 form the first fire outlet structure 42, so that the first fire outlet structure 42 has a certain height from the fire row body 41. Compared with the scheme of directly opening the fire hole on the fire row body 41, the first fire outlet hole 422 extends in the height direction, not only plays a certain guiding role to the mixed gas flow, but also lengthens the distance between the flame above the protrusion 421 and the mixed gas flow below the fire row body 41. When the mixed gas flow speed decreases, the lengthened distance can effectively prevent backfire from occurring, so that the burner 202 can still work stably under low load, widen the water temperature adjustment range, and meet the use demand of users for wider temperature range and more precise water temperature control.
[0068] In some embodiments, the plurality of first fire outlet structures 42 are uniformly and densely arranged on the fire row body 41, the first fire outlet hole 422 of the first fire outlet structure 42 is smaller than the quenching diameter of the gas, which can effectively prevent backfire; when the flame has a tendency to spread inward, it will be extinguished when passing through the first fire outlet hole 422 due to the cooling of the hole wall of the first fire outlet hole 422. In addition, this design makes the combustion flame very short and close to the surface of the fire row body 41, forming a uniform fire film and achieving a flameless combustion state. This combustion method has uniform temperature distribution, can avoid the generation of local high-temperature points, and can increase the combustion specific surface area to provide multiple outlets for the gas-air mixture, so that it can be completely combusted instantaneously. The large combustion area not only ensures sufficient combustion of the gas and significantly reduces the generation of carbon monoxide, but also avoids the emission of nitrides due to the absence of local high temperatures, and the heat can be quickly transferred to the heating surface, greatly reducing the loss of heat carried by high-temperature flue gas escaping, thereby significantly improving the thermal efficiency.

[0075] In other embodiments, such as Figure 5 As shown, the fire rack 4 also includes a second fire outlet structure 43. The second fire outlet structure 43 is provided between two adjacent groups of first fire outlet structures. The fire rack body 41 is provided with a second fire outlet hole 431, and the fire rack body 41 is provided with a blocking member 432 that blocks the second fire outlet hole 431 at intervals. The distance between the blocking member 432 and the fire rack body 41 is less than the distance between the protrusion 421 and the fire rack body 41. The blocking member 432 and the second fire outlet hole 431 form the second fire outlet structure 43. When the mixed gas inside the burner housing 1 is ejected from the second flame outlet 431 and ignited, the flame at that location mainly spreads to both sides under the action of the shielding member 432. When it spreads to the wall of the adjacent protrusion 421, it is blocked, thereby connecting the flames of the first flame outlet 422 at each protrusion 421 and forming a continuous and uniform flame layer on the entire surface of the burner body 41. The flame height is low, and it burns close to the surface of the burner body 41, forming a uniform fire film, achieving a state similar to flameless combustion.
[0076] This low-flame combustion not only ensures uniform temperature distribution, preventing localized high-temperature spots, but also, because the flame root is stable at the outlet of the flame port, the outflow velocity of combustible gas is always higher than the flame propagation velocity, preventing the flame from backfiring into the firebox 4 and fundamentally eliminating the risk of backfire. Furthermore, the lower flame allows for a more compact design of the combustion chamber 2012, eliminating the need to reserve excessive space for a tall flame, thus contributing to overall miniaturization. At the same time, the stable flame combustion surface avoids violent flame shaking and turbulence, making the combustion process smoother and quieter, significantly reducing combustion noise.
[0077] Continue as Figure 5 As shown, multiple second flame outlet structures 43 are arranged at intervals along a first direction between two adjacent groups of first flame outlet structures. The area of the second flame outlet hole 431 of the second flame outlet structure 43 located in the middle position along the first direction is larger than the area of the second flame outlet holes 431 in the other positions. In other words, the area of the second flame outlet hole 431 located in the middle position along the first direction is larger than the area of the other second flame outlet holes 431. This is because the gas flow rate in the middle position along the first direction is greater than the gas flow rate in the edge region. Matching a second flame outlet hole 431 with a larger area here facilitates a balanced and stable gas flow, ensuring stable flame combustion.
[0078] In Figure 5 In the example shown, the second fire outlet hole 431 is a rectangular hole, and the length direction of the second fire outlet hole 431 extends along the first direction. In this way, one second fire outlet hole 431 can correspond to multiple first fire outlet holes 422 arranged along the first direction at the same time, which not only reduces the number of second fire outlet structures 43, but also allows the second fire outlet hole 431 to have a larger hole area, thereby providing a larger outflow gap for the gas flow to ensure stable combustion of the flame.
[0079] In addition, the fire row body 41 is also provided with a pilot hole 44, which is arranged opposite to the ignition assembly 204, and the ignition assembly 204 preferentially ignites the gas at the pilot hole 44.
[0080] In some embodiments, as Figure 6 shown, the diameter of the first fire outlet hole 422 gradually decreases from the direction in which the fire row body 41 is located to the direction away from the fire row body 41. In other words, the diameter of the inlet of the first fire outlet hole 422 is larger than the diameter of the outlet of the first fire outlet hole 422, which can facilitate the gas flow to quickly enter the first fire outlet hole 422 from the inlet of the first fire outlet hole 422 and be accelerated to be discharged at the outlet of the first fire outlet hole 422 under the conical guiding action of the first fire outlet hole 422, so that the outflow speed of the gas flow is greater than the flame burning speed, which not only plays an important role in stabilizing the flame, but also prevents backfire. Exemplarily, the diameter of the outlet of the first fire outlet hole 422 is 0.5 mm, and the diameter of the inlet of the first fire outlet hole 422 is 0.55 mm, which helps to accelerate the outflow of the gas.
[0081] Further, the protrusion 421 is a circular truncated cone, and the diameter of the protrusion 421 gradually decreases from the direction in which the fire row body 41 is located to the direction away from the fire row body 41. The shape of the protrusion 421 can block and guide the flame generated by the adjacent protrusion 421 and the second fire outlet structure 43, so as to form a stable low-flame combustion state.

[0083] As Figure 7 In combination Figure 3As shown, the burner 202 further comprises a flow uniformizing plate 3, the top of the burner shell 1 is provided with a flange, the flow uniformizing plate 3 and the fire grate 4 are both fixed to the flange, and the flow uniformizing plate 3 is located below the fire grate 4. The flow uniformizing plate 3 is provided with a plurality of flow uniformizing holes 31 arranged at intervals. The mixed gas of gas and air can be further uniformly diffused under the action of the flow uniformizing holes 31, so as to reduce the difference in gas flow rate at each position on the surface of the fire grate 4, thereby ensuring the stability of combustion. In addition, by providing the flange on the top of the burner shell 1, the flow uniformizing plate 3 and the fire grate 4 can be installed on the flange, which can simplify the structure of the burner shell 1, and reasonably arrange the components of the burner 202, so that the overall structure is more compact and the size is smaller.
[0084] Continuing as in 7 Figure 5 As shown, the fire grate body 41 comprises an opening portion 411 and a fixing portion 412 surrounding the periphery of the opening portion 411. The opening portion 411 protrudes away from the flow uniformizing plate 3 relative to the fixing portion 412, and the opening portion 411 is used to arrange the first fire outlet structure 42 and the second fire outlet structure 43. The fixing portion 412 is used to be fixedly connected with the burner shell 1.
[0085] As shown in Figure 6 The distance between the opening portion 411 and the flow uniformizing plate 3 first increases and then decreases along the first direction, that is, the distance between the opening portion 411 and the flow uniformizing plate 3 first increases and then decreases from the front side of the flow uniformizing plate 3 to the rear side thereof. After the mixed gas of gas and air flows out of the premixing flow channel 10, it is preferentially concentrated at the middle position of the flow uniformizing plate 3 in the front-rear direction, so that the mixed gas at this position is more concentrated. In order to ensure that the mixed gas in different regions can smoothly flow out from the flow uniformizing holes 31 and the fire holes, the distance between the opening portion 411 and the flow uniformizing plate 3 first increases and then decreases from the front side of the flow uniformizing plate 3 to the rear side thereof, in other words, the distance between the opening portion 411 at the middle position in the front-rear direction and the flow uniformizing plate 3 is the largest, which can better adapt to the flow of a large amount of mixed gas of gas and air. Exemplarily, the opening portion 411 is approximately arc-shaped.
